From a Columbia release announcement in Talking machine world (Nov. 1906): "Record 'C' opens with a dashing chorus, 'Stand up and fight like a man,' introduces lively, humorous dialogues, and concludes with 'Dixie Dear' by Billy Murray, with quartette chorus. An enthusing record." |
